How Karl Marx’s Ideas Actually Work Today

Far from abstract theory, Marx’s concepts offer frameworks for analyzing power and inequality. At their heart, they highlight how economic systems shape opportunity—and how hierarchies persist when designed without checks. His emphasis on dialectical change—how conflict drives evolution—offers a lens for understanding political shifts, union growth, and innovation cycles in today’s economy. While not a manifesto, his ideas function as critical tools for questioning status Quo structures encountered in public policy, corporate leadership, and social justice efforts.
